EMDR Q & A
What is EMDR?
EMDR, also called eye-movement desensitization and reprocessing, is a highly effective treatment for anxiety, post-traumatic stress disorder (PTSD), and other mental health conditions that you or a loved one may encounter. It’s an 8-phase treatment program that helps you process and heal from past traumatic events.

What should I expect during EMDR sessions?
During EMDR sessions, you rest in a relaxing room with a compassionate mental health specialist. They encourage you to briefly focus on a traumatic memory while participating in bilateral eye movements. The treatment helps reduce the vividness and emotions associated with traumatic memories, helping your mind desensitize itself to past trauma.
